   You  do the same routine day after day. Back then you had nothing to take for granted, let’s face it, everything was new. After time we fall into molds, molds we’ve created unconsciously. It’s time to break the mold and make it new again. Let’s look into a few things that can help bring back that luster.

 

   First, change the order of things the best you can. Granted some things must come at the beginning of the day, but there is a lot that can be juggled around.

 

    Second, you start your meetings at 10:00am every day; make it a half hour earlier or later instead. It will get your meetings to become a bit more interesting if you change the starting topic as well.  If needed bring up the most crucial first, then change it up.

Image   Third, check e-mails at a different time slot. Maybe half in the morning and the other before you call it a day.

   Forth, take lunch at a different time; bring someone other than the same old people. And it doesn’t have to be about work all the time. Change the conversation like sports, the weather, etc.

  Fifth, take a pleasure tour of your shop; greet your employees with enthusiasm. That will wake them up. This is supposed to be a cordial moment.

 

   These  are just a few small steps to take away the hum-drum out of everyday at the office. Remembering why you started in the first place is the right and first place to start.
